About Grenada, Mississippi

Grenada is a locality in Grenada County, Mississippi, United States. It has a population of 12,375. The population density is 160.6 people per km². Grenada is located at 33.7690°N, 89.8084°W. It observes the Central Time (America/Chicago) timezone. ZIP code: 38901.
